Electric Hedge Trimmer Market Outlook for Professional Hedge Trimmers Segment

The global electric hedge trimmer market is experiencing steady growth as consumers and professionals increasingly shift toward eco-friendly and efficient landscaping tools. The market is projected to be valued at US$1.5 billion in 2026 and is expected to reach approximately US$2.1 billion by 2033, expanding at a CAGR of 5.4% during the forecast period. This growth is largely driven by rising environmental awareness, stricter emission regulations, and the growing preference for electric garden tools over traditional gasoline-powered equipment. Electric hedge trimmers offer several advantages, including lower noise levels, reduced maintenance, ease of use, and improved operational safety, making them an attractive choice for residential and commercial users alike.

A key factor accelerating market expansion is the rapid advancement in battery technologies, particularly lithium-ion batteries, which provide longer runtime, faster charging, and enhanced durability. The cordless electric hedge trimmer segment leads the market due to its convenience, portability, and suitability for both small and large-scale landscaping tasks. In terms of geography, Europe dominates the electric hedge trimmer market, driven by strong environmental regulations, a well-established gardening culture, and widespread adoption of sustainable landscaping practices. Additionally, increasing urbanization and the popularity of home gardening in emerging economies are further contributing to global market growth.

Market Segmentation

The electric hedge trimmer market is segmented based on product type, blade type, power source, and end-user applications. In terms of product type, the market is divided into corded electric hedge trimmers and cordless electric hedge trimmers. Cordless models are gaining significant traction due to their mobility and ease of handling, especially in areas where access to power outlets is limited. Meanwhile, corded hedge trimmers continue to be preferred for continuous, heavy-duty applications where uninterrupted power supply is essential.

Based on blade type, the market includes single-sided and double-sided blades. Double-sided blades are more popular among professional landscapers as they allow faster and more efficient trimming from both directions, improving productivity. On the other hand, single-sided blades are commonly used by residential users for precision trimming and easier control. The power source segment is dominated by battery-powered tools, particularly lithium-ion batteries, which provide higher energy density and longer lifespan compared to traditional battery types.

From an end-user perspective, the market is categorized into residential and commercial users. The residential segment accounts for a substantial share due to the rising popularity of home gardening and landscaping as a hobby. Commercial users, including landscaping service providers and municipal authorities, also contribute significantly to market demand, as they require reliable and efficient tools for maintaining public spaces, parks, and gardens.

Regional Insights

Europe holds a leading position in the electric hedge trimmer market, supported by strong environmental policies and a high level of consumer awareness regarding sustainable practices. Countries such as Germany, the UK, and France have a well-established gardening culture, which drives consistent demand for advanced landscaping tools. Additionally, government incentives promoting eco-friendly equipment further support market growth in the region.

North America represents another significant market, driven by the increasing adoption of electric outdoor power equipment and the growing trend of DIY gardening and landscaping. The presence of major market players and technological innovation also contribute to the region’s growth. In the Asia-Pacific region, the market is expanding rapidly due to urbanization, rising disposable incomes, and increasing interest in home improvement and gardening activities. Countries like China, Japan, and India are witnessing growing demand for electric hedge trimmers, particularly in urban areas. Meanwhile, Latin America and the Middle East & Africa are gradually adopting electric gardening tools, supported by improving infrastructure and awareness of sustainable solutions.

Market Drivers

The primary driver of the electric hedge trimmer market is the increasing shift toward environmentally friendly and energy-efficient gardening tools. Traditional gasoline-powered hedge trimmers emit harmful pollutants and require frequent maintenance, making electric alternatives a more sustainable choice. The growing adoption of cordless tools, powered by advanced lithium-ion batteries, has further enhanced user convenience by eliminating the need for power cords and reducing operational constraints. Additionally, rising urbanization and the expansion of residential spaces with gardens and lawns are boosting demand for easy-to-use landscaping equipment. Technological advancements, including ergonomic designs, lightweight materials, and safety features, are also encouraging consumers to adopt electric hedge trimmers.

Market Restraints

Despite its growth potential, the market faces certain challenges that may hinder its expansion. One of the key restraints is the limited runtime of battery-powered hedge trimmers compared to gasoline-powered models, which can affect productivity during prolonged use. Although battery technology is improving, concerns regarding charging time and battery replacement costs persist among users. Additionally, corded electric hedge trimmers are restricted by the length of power cords, limiting their mobility and usability in larger areas. Price sensitivity in emerging markets can also act as a barrier, as electric hedge trimmers are often perceived as more expensive than traditional alternatives.
